Output 6c107c2980150de8f0699e6d06ce2358e34d8b0cabfa840e4a4803038fddf8a9:1

value
6963486498873
script pubkey
OP_0 OP_PUSHBYTES_20 7b8bd26748cc6a189b81611c79d9bd45f920a89d
address
tb1q0w9aye6ge34p3xupvyw8nkdaghujp2ya96yjhl
transaction
6c107c2980150de8f0699e6d06ce2358e34d8b0cabfa840e4a4803038fddf8a9
confirmations
187198
spent
true